# How to use “else” correctly in English

By [English Tips](https://paragraph.com/@english-tips) · 2022-07-15

---

A typical mistake non-native English speakers often make: using the word _else_ instead of _otherwise_.

For example:

> ❌ If the weather is good, we’ll go for a walk, **else** we’ll stay inside.

It would sound much more natural to use _otherwise_:

> ✔️ If the weather is good, we’ll go for a walk, **otherwise** we’ll stay inside.

_Else_ is mostly used in phrases like “someone else”, “what else”, “nothing else” etc.

> ✔️ Who **else** wants to play?

> ✔️ Open mind for a different view / And nothing **else** matters

Remember: English isn’t a C-like programming language!
